In the Engravings Office of the department of the foreign arts of the Astrakhan Picture Gallery as part of the Year of Culture of Great Britain and Russia takes place the exhibition of English engraving and book of English press of the XVIII – XIX centuries “This special world…”.

The exhibition project presents a picture of the development of Russian culture and the main artistic trends over the past two centuries - from the social criticism that characterizes the Enlightenment, to free imaginative solutions of the Romantic period.

The exposition included samples of collection of prints in the art tool, etching, mezzotint and woodcut executed by British artists-engravers, including publishing projects, reflecting the legacy of the British school of drawing and watercolors, reproduction proofs with paintings of the London National Gallery.

An integral part of the artistic panorama of the XVIII century engravings are based on the works of the English artist and art theorist William Hogarth (1697-1764).

For the first time in the exhibition are presented illustrations of the famous magazine-newspaper "Illustrated London News" (1842-1890) from the collection of the Krupskaya Astrakhan Regional Library.
